Understanding the Poland Work Permit Visa 2025

What is a Poland Work Permit Visa?

A Poland Work Permit Visa is a legal document that allows non-EU/EEA citizens to work in Poland. It is a crucial step for anyone looking to take up employment in the country. The work permit is typically issued for a specific job and employer, and it is valid for a defined period.

Types of Work Permits in Poland

Poland offers several types of work permits depending on the nature and duration of employment:

  1. Type A Work Permit: For employment based on a contract with a Polish employer.
  2. Type B Work Permit: For individuals who are members of the management board of a company in Poland.
  3. Type C Work Permit: For foreign workers delegated to Poland for more than 30 days in a calendar year.
  4. Type D Work Permit: For individuals working in Poland based on a contract with a foreign employer.
  5. Type E Work Permit: For foreign workers performing work in Poland that is not covered by other types of permits.

Eligibility Criteria for Poland Work Permit Visa 2025

To be eligible for a Poland Work Permit Visa in 2025, applicants must meet the following criteria:

  1. Job Offer: You must have a valid job offer from a Polish employer.
  2. Qualifications: You must possess the necessary qualifications and experience required for the job.
  3. Labor Market Test: In most cases, the employer must prove that there are no suitable candidates from Poland or the EU/EEA for the position.
  4. Health Insurance: You must have valid health insurance coverage.
  5. Clean Criminal Record: You must provide a clean criminal record from your home country.
  6. Valid Passport: Your passport must be valid for at least six months beyond your intended stay in Poland.

Required Documents for Poland Work Permit Visa 2025

When applying for a Poland Work Permit Visa, you will need to submit the following documents:

  1. Completed Application Form: Available on the official website of the Polish consulate or embassy.
  2. Passport-Sized Photos: Recent photos that meet the specified requirements.
  3. Valid Passport: A copy of your passport’s bio page.
  4. Job Offer Letter: A formal job offer from a Polish employer.
  5. Employment Contract: A signed contract detailing the terms of your employment.
  6. Proof of Qualifications: Diplomas, certificates, or other documents proving your qualifications.
  7. Health Insurance: Proof of valid health insurance coverage.
  8. Criminal Record Certificate: A clean criminal record from your home country.
  9. Proof of Accommodation: Evidence of where you will be staying in Poland.
  10. Application Fee: Payment of the required visa fee.

Step-by-Step Application Process for Poland Work Permit Visa 2025

  1. Secure a Job Offer: The first step is to secure a job offer from a Polish employer. The employer will initiate the work permit application process on your behalf.
  2. Labor Market Test: Your employer must conduct a labor market test to prove that there are no suitable candidates from Poland or the EU/EEA for the position.
  3. Work Permit Application: Once the labor market test is completed, your employer will submit the work permit application to the relevant Voivodeship Office in Poland.
  4. Wait for Approval: The processing time for a work permit can vary, but it typically takes around 1-3 months. Once approved, you will receive a work permit.
  5. Visa Application: With the work permit in hand, you can apply for a work visa at the nearest Polish consulate or embassy in your home country.
  6. Travel to Poland: Once your visa is approved, you can travel to Poland and start your new job.
